The degree of hyperglycemia can change over time depending on the metabolic cause, for example, impaired glucose tolerance or fasting glucose, and it can depend on treatment. Temporary hyperglycemia is often benign and asymptomatic. Blood glucose levels can rise well above normal and cause pathological and functional changes for significant periods without producing any permanent effects or symptoms. Then you drink a sugary liquid, and blood sugar levels are tested regularly … Web16 mei 2024 · Postprandial hyperglycaemia is defined as a plasma glucose level>7.8 mmol/L (140 mg/dL) 1-2 hours after ingestion of food[8–9]. In contrast, postprandial glucose level in people with normal glucose tolerance is less than 7.8 mmol/L (140 mg/dL) in response to meals and typically returns to premeal levels within two to three hours.
